What’s a New Detached ADU in South Miami Heights Going to Take?

A new detached ADU in South Miami Heights is a standalone living unit built on your property, separate from your main house, complete with its own kitchen, bathroom, sleeping area, and independent utility connections. Most projects we manage in the 33177 area run 4 to 7 months from permit approval to final inspection, with construction itself typically spanning 12 to 16 weeks. Budget-wise, you’re looking at roughly $90,000 to $220,000 depending on size, foundation needs, and whether you go stick-built or prefab. How We Build a New Detached ADU in South Miami Heights

We’ve learned that homeowners sleep better when they know what happens when. Here’s the actual sequence we follow for every new detached ADU in South Miami Heights, with the decisions you’ll need to make at each stage.

Stage 1: Site evaluation and feasibility (1-2 weeks)

We walk your lot with a surveyor’s eye, checking setbacks, easements, and that septic-or-sewer question that comes up constantly in South Miami Heights. Many 1960s-1980s CBS homes here still run on septic, and Miami-Dade County’s Health Department has specific separation requirements between a new ADU’s drainfield and the existing system’s components. You’ll decide at this stage: stick-built from the slab up, or prefab delivered in modules? We’ll also flag any rock conditions early, since the shallow Miami oolitic limestone beneath this area can turn a standard footing dig into a rock-cutting operation.

Stage 2: Design and permitting (6-10 weeks)

Because South Miami Heights is unincorporated, every permit routes through Miami-Dade County’s building department, not a local city hall. We prepare architectural plans, structural calcs for HVHZ wind loads, and Miami-Dade NOA documentation for every material and assembly. You’ll choose your exterior finish, window package, and roof type here. We typically spec impact-rated windows and doors from our Andersen, Pella, or CGI lines, and James Hardie siding holds up well against the combination of salt air, intense sun, and hurricane-season moisture we see in South Miami Heights.

Stage 3: Site prep and foundation (2-3 weeks)

This is where the limestone either cooperates or doesn’t. Standard trenching for footings, drainage, and utility stub-outs can require hydraulic rock hammers when bedrock sits just below grade, which it often does in this corridor. We engineer drainage aggressively, the flat terrain and high seasonal water table here won’t forgive a poorly sloped slab. You’ll sign off on final utility routing: tying into existing sewer if available, or coordinating with the county on septic capacity and placement.

Stage 4: Structure and rough-in (4-6 weeks)

Framing goes up, roof decking and HVHZ-rated shingles follow, then plumbing, electrical, and HVAC rough-in. Our electrical runs get inspected before we close walls. In South Miami Heights, the county inspection queue can stack up during busy seasons, so we build buffer into this phase. You’ll make your interior material selections now: cabinetry from KraftMaid or Wellborn, countertop material from Cambria’s quartz line or another surface from our roster, flooring, fixtures, and paint.

Stage 5: Finish and final inspection (3-4 weeks)

Drywall, paint, flooring, cabinet and countertop install, fixture set, appliance connection. We run our own punch list before calling for the county’s final. Once Miami-Dade signs off, your ADU is ready for occupancy, rental, or family move-in. The whole process, from our first site walk to certificate of occupancy, typically spans 5 to 8 months in this market.

The Build Choices You’ll Actually Face

Every new detached ADU in South Miami Heights forces a handful of real decisions. Here’s how we talk through them with homeowners:

  • Stick-built vs. prefab: Traditional framing on your foundation gives maximum flexibility on layout and finish, but adds 2-4 weeks to the schedule. Prefab units from our partners at Abodu, Dvele, or Mighty Buildings arrive 70-90% complete and can cut construction time in half, though you’re working within their module dimensions and finish palettes. Prefab often lands in the lower half of our $90,000-$220,000 range for comparable square footage; stick-built pushes toward the upper half but lets you match your main house exactly.
  • Foundation type: Monolithic slab is standard for South Miami Heights, but if your lot has significant rock or drainage challenges, a stem-wall foundation with elevated slab adds $8,000-$15,000. The trade-off is better flood resilience and easier utility routing in problem soils.
  • Roofing assembly: Low-slope TPO or modified bitumen matches the aesthetic of many 33177 neighborhood homes, but a pitched shingle roof with a GAF or CertainTeed HVHZ-rated system sheds rain faster during our June-October deluges and adds attic storage. Pitch adds roughly $3,000-$6,000 on a typical 400-600 square foot ADU.
  • Kitchen and bath spec level: A rental-focused ADU gets durable, easy-clean finishes, laminate or entry-level quartz countertops, and fiberglass shower surrounds. A family guesthouse or aging-in-law suite might warrant Cambria countertops, KraftMaid semi-custom cabinetry, and a tiled walk-in shower. The spread between these two approaches can be $8,000-$15,000 on a compact kitchen and bath package.
  • Utility independence: Separate electrical meter and water tap adds upfront cost but gives true rental independence. Tapping into existing services saves money but can complicate tenant billing and may trigger main-panel upgrades if your house is already near capacity, common in older South Miami Heights homes with original 100-amp service.

What New Detached ADU Costs in South Miami Heights, FL

For a new detached ADU in South Miami Heights, expect to invest between $90,000 and $220,000. That’s a wide span because the variables are real and specific to your property.

Here is what moves you toward the low end versus the high end:

  • Size and layout complexity: A 400-square-foot studio with a simple rectangular footprint runs far leaner than a 700-square-foot one-bedroom with bump-outs, covered entry, or covered porch.
  • Foundation and site conditions: Standard slab on cooperative soil keeps costs down. Rock excavation, poor drainage requiring engineered fill, or septic system relocation can add $10,000-$25,000.
  • Utility extension distance: Trenching electrical, water, and sewer 20 feet from your main house is one thing. Running 80 feet across a mature lot with existing hardscaping to save is another.
  • Material and finish grade: Rental-grade finishes with vinyl flooring and stock cabinetry versus quartz counters, hardwood-look LVP, and semi-custom KraftMaid or Wellborn cabinets can swing interior costs by 40%.
  • Prefab vs. site-built: As noted above, prefab typically compresses both timeline and total cost, though site-built offers design freedom that many homeowners in established South Miami Heights neighborhoods value for aesthetic consistency.

A written estimate from us itemizes foundation, framing, roofing, MEP rough-in and finish, insulation, drywall, flooring, cabinets, countertops, fixtures, paint, and cleanup. It does not include permit fees, which Miami-Dade County sets by valuation, or any required septic system modification, which the Health Department prices separately. We flag both as line-item estimates so you’re not surprised.

What South Miami Heights Specifically Does to This Job

South Miami Heights sits in the corridor that Hurricane Andrew flattened in 1992, and that history still shapes every new detached ADU we build here. The pre-1992 CBS homes on lots throughout the 33177 ZIP, many with flat roofs and galvanized plumbing now sixty years old, stand alongside post-Andrew rebuilds engineered to Miami-Dade’s High Velocity Hurricane Zone code. For your ADU, there’s no opting out: every material and assembly must carry a Miami-Dade Notice of Acceptance, from the roof shingles to the window fasteners to the exterior sheathing attachment pattern.

Because South Miami Heights is unincorporated, your permits don’t go to a city hall down the street. They route through the Miami-Dade County building department, where rough, structural, electrical, plumbing, and final inspections queue against demand from across the county. Experienced local contractors build an extra week of inspection buffer into every schedule rather than promising next-day turnaround that the system can’t deliver.

The shallow limestone beneath this area is another local reality. We’ve hit bedrock six inches below grade on lots near SW 112th Avenue that required rock hammers for footing trenches. That changes pricing and timing compared to contractors working inland on deeper, softer soils. And with many homes still on septic rather than county sewer, your ADU’s square footage and bedroom count may be constrained by drainfield setbacks and percolation capacity, a design limitation that doesn’t exist in sewer-served neighborhoods just north of here.
